10 FAQS on Jim Corbett National Park

Jim Corbett National Park is a protected area in Uttarakhand, India, and was established in 1936 as Hailey National Park. It is renowned for its diverse wildlife, including Bengal tigers, and is a popular destination for ecotourism and wildlife sightings.
The park is located in the Nainital and Pauri Garhwal districts of Uttarakhand, in the northern part of India.
The best time to visit Jim Corbett National Park is from November to June when the weather is pleasant and wildlife sightings are more common. The park is closed during the monsoon season from July to October.
Visitors can find a range of accommodation options near Jim Corbett National Park, from budget-friendly guesthouses to luxury resorts and forest rest houses.
Yes, visitors can go on jeep or elephant safaris to explore the park and view wildlife. Safaris need to be booked in advance through the park's official website or authorized travel agents.
There are entry fees for visiting the park, and permits are required for safaris, which are issued on a first-come-first-serve basis. Different zones of the park may have additional entry restrictions to control the number of visitors and protect wildlife.
The park is home to a significant population of Bengal tigers, as well as other wildlife such as Asian elephants, leopards, various species of deer, sloth bears, and a diverse array of bird species.
Visiting the park is generally safe with adherence to guidelines and instructions provided by park authorities. Safaris are conducted by experienced guides to ensure the safety of visitors and the protection of wildlife.
Yes, there are many tour operators that offer guided tours of Jim Corbett National Park. These tours often include wildlife safaris, bird watching, and other ecotourism activities.
Visitors should wear comfortable clothing suitable for outdoor activities, and carry necessities such as a camera, binoculars, sunscreen, insect repellent, a hat, and water. During winter months, warm clothing is recommended.
